Kissimmee, Fla. (5/22/17) The Dominican College golf team wrapped up day one at the NCAA Division II National Golf Championships being played on the Watson Course at The Reunion Resort. Dominican had a day one combined score of 307.
DC sits in 19th place overall with the day one score in their first national championship appearance on the par 70 course.
Sophomore Hunter Wescott (Portland, Ore.) and freshman Jayce Robinson (Sparks, Nev.) are tied for 78th place overall with a first round score of 76 (+6).
Daniel Parker (Ocean City, Md.) had a score of 77 (+7) to be tied for 90th place.
Freshman Carlos Armas Stenner (Durango, Mexico) is tied for 98th place with a first round score of 78 (+8), while Leonard Lee (Wyckoff, N.J.) had a first day total of 80 (+10) to be in a tie for 103rd place.
The Chargers return to the links tomorrow morning for day two of the National Championships. Stenner will lead off for Dominican at 7:30 tomorrow morning on hole 1.
